When Did Carbon Emissions Become A Problem?

The concern over carbon emissions can be traced back to the Industrial Revolution, primarily in the late 18th and early 19th centuries. This period marked a seismic shift in human activity as societies transitioned from agrarian economies to industrialized nations. The use of coal as a primary energy source skyrocketed during this time, and while it powered factories and fueled transportation, it simultaneously released significant amounts of carbon dioxide (CO2) into the atmosphere. The rapid increase in carbon emissions through burning fossil fuels began to alter the Earth’s natural carbon cycle, setting the stage for future environmental challenges.

Scientific Recognition in the 19th Century

Fast forward to the mid-19th century, and scientists began to connect the dots between human activities and the greenhouse effect. Researchers like John Tyndall identified that gases, including CO2 and methane, could trap heat in the atmosphere. Although this was a significant scientific breakthrough, the broader implications of these findings did not immediately resonate with society at large. It wasn’t until later that the consequences of increased carbon emissions would gain attention, prompting a more profound exploration into how these changes could affect global climates.

The 1960s and 1970s: An Environmental Awakening

The 1960s brought forth a significant cultural shift where environmental issues began to surface more prominently in public discourse. The publication of Rachel Carson’s “Silent Spring” in 1962 played a pivotal role in raising awareness of the environmental crisis stemming from human actions. Around this time, the first Earth Day was celebrated in 1970, marking a significant moment in the environmental movement. This was also a period when increasing data on carbon emissions began to reveal their destructive potential, indicating that unchecked industrial practices could lead to severe climatic shifts.

Global Climate Conferences: A Wake-Up Call

By the late 20th century, carbon emissions had reached alarming levels, prompting global leaders to convene at various environmental summits. The 1992 Earth Summit in Rio de Janeiro drew international attention to climate change, leading to the establishment of the United Nations Framework Convention on Climate Change (UNFCCC). This marked a turning point in recognizing carbon emissions as a global issue requiring collective action. The acknowledgment that human activities were contributing to climate change motivated countries to develop policies aimed at curtailing greenhouse gas emissions.

The Kyoto Protocol: Holding Nations Accountable

Following the Earth Summit, the Kyoto Protocol, adopted in 1997, sought to bind developed countries to emission reduction targets. This agreement represented a significant step forward in the global fight against climate change, directly linking carbon emissions to international policy and cooperative efforts. However, political resistance and debates over equity and responsibility delayed progress, highlighting the complexities of addressing global carbon emissions amid varying economic interests and priorities.

The New Millennium: A Growing Crisis

Entering the 21st century, concerns over carbon emissions reached new heights. The Intergovernmental Panel on Climate Change (IPCC) began releasing comprehensive reports highlighting the undeniable linkage between rising carbon emissions and climate change. Around this time, extreme weather events became more frequent, raising public awareness and prompting a sense of urgency regarding the issue. The narrative shifted to viewing carbon emissions as not just an environmental concern but a pressing humanitarian issue, threatening livelihoods and ecosystems across the globe.

Recent Years: The Race Against Time

As we venture further into the 21st century, the urgency to address carbon emissions has intensified. With growing global temperatures, melting ice caps, and unprecedented natural disasters, more individuals and organizations are rallying for change. The Paris Agreement, adopted in 2015, represented a global commitment to reduce carbon emissions, aiming to limit temperature rise to below 2 degrees Celsius. While progress has been made, the gap between current emission trajectories and necessary reductions has raised alarms among scientists and activists alike.
